Hi Dominic,

There are some ways to control the metric value in ospf.

1. There is also the "ip ospf cost" interface command.

2. you can change the numerator on the metric calculation formula by using the "auto-cost reference-bandwith" router config command (default is 100)

3. When you do summarization on the ABR's, you can use the "area x range ....... cost" router config command.

4. On redistribution you can use the "default-metric" router config command, or configure the metric under the "redistribute" command.
